▲What Are Rail Clips▲

 

Rail clips, also known as rail fasteners or rail anchors, are essential components in railway track systems. They are designed to securely fasten rails to the underlying base, such as concrete sleepers or wooden ties, ensuring stability and safety of the track. 

Rail clips are critical for maintaining the integrity of the railway track, ensuring smooth and safe passage of trains. They help distribute the loads generated by passing trains and prevent rail movement, reducing the risk of derailment and other accidents. Proper installation and maintenance of rail clips are essential for the efficient and safe operation of railways.

▲Rail Clips manufacturing process▲

 

▲ Material Selection

 

Rail clips are made from high-strength steel or other durable materials capable of withstanding the stresses and demands of railway operations. The material chosen must meet specific standards and requirements for strength, elasticity, and corrosion resistance.

 

▲ Forming

 

The selected material is then processed through forming techniques such as hot forging, cold forging, or stamping to shape it into the desired rail clip design. This involves applying pressure to the material using specialized machinery to create the necessary contours, holes, and dimensions.

 

▲ Heat Treatment

 

After forming, the rail clips may undergo heat treatment processes such as quenching and tempering to improve their mechanical properties. Heat treatment helps enhance the strength, hardness, and toughness of the material, ensuring that the rail clips can withstand the loads and stresses experienced in railway applications.

▲ Surface Treatment

 

Rail clips often undergo surface treatment processes to improve their corrosion resistance and durability. This may include techniques such as galvanization, zinc coating, or other protective coatings to protect the rail clips from environmental factors such as moisture, chemicals, and abrasion.

 

▲ Assembly

 

Depending on the design of the rail clip and the specific requirements of the railway track system, additional components such as nuts, bolts, or washers may be assembled onto the rail clip. This ensures that the rail clip can be securely attached to the rail and the underlying base.

 

▲ Quality Control

 

Throughout the manufacturing process, rigorous quality control measures are implemented to ensure that the rail clips meet the required standards and specifications. This includes inspections of raw materials, dimensional checks during forming, and testing of mechanical properties, surface finish, and corrosion resistance.

 

▲Types of Rail Clips▲

 

▲ Elastic Rail Clips

 

Elastic Rail Clips are among the most widely used rail clips in modern railway systems. They feature a spring-like design that provides elasticity, allowing the rail to expand and contract with temperature changes while maintaining a secure grip on the rail base. Elastic rail clips help absorb shocks and vibrations, reducing noise and extending the life of the track components.

 

▲ Pandrol Clips

 

Pandrol clips are a type of elastic rail clip widely used in railway tracks worldwide. They provide continuous clamping force to the rail, ensuring stability and reducing the risk of rail movement and derailments. Pandrol clips are known for their reliability, durability, and ease of installation.

 

▲ KPO Clips

 

KPO clips, also known as SKL clips, are commonly used in heavy-haul railway tracks. They feature a sturdy design with high clamping force, making them suitable for applications where heavy loads and high speeds are involved. KPO clips are often used in conjunction with resilient pads to further reduce noise and vibration.

 

▲ Crane Rail Clips

 

Crane Rail Clips are specifically designed for securing crane rails, which are used in industrial settings for heavy-duty applications such as ports, factories, and warehouses. Crane rail clips are typically robust and durable to withstand the extreme loads and conditions encountered in crane operations.

 

▲ Deenik Clips

 

Deenik clips, also known as Deenik fasteners, are commonly used in tramway and light rail systems. They feature a simple design with a threaded shank that is bolted to the rail base, providing secure fastening while allowing for easy installation and maintenance.

 

▲ PR Clips

 

PR clips are designed for long-term use without the need for frequent adjustments or replacements. They provide a reliable and low-maintenance solution for securing rails to the base, ensuring stability and safety in railway tracks.

▲Rail Clips maintenance▲

 

▲ Regular Inspections

 

Conduct regular visual inspections of rail clips to identify signs of wear, damage, or deterioration. Inspect for loose bolts, cracked or broken clips, corrosion, and any other abnormalities that may affect the performance of the rail clips.

 

▲ Tightening

 

Check the tightness of bolts or fasteners securing the rail clips to the rail base. Loose bolts can compromise the integrity of the rail clip and lead to rail movement or failure. Tighten loose bolts to the manufacturer's recommended torque specifications.

 

▲ Replacement

 

Replace damaged or worn rail clips as needed. This may involve removing the old clips and installing new ones to ensure proper fastening and stability of the rail. Pay attention to areas where rail clips are frequently subjected to high loads or wear, such as curves, switches, and crossings.

 

▲ Cleaning

 

Keep rail clips clean and free of debris, rust, grease, or other contaminants that may interfere with their performance. Use appropriate cleaning methods and equipment to remove dirt and debris from the rail clips and surrounding areas.

 

▲ Lubrication

 

Apply lubricants to moving parts of rail clips, such as springs or sliding surfaces, to reduce friction and wear. Lubrication helps maintain the functionality and longevity of rail clips, especially in areas with high levels of vibration or exposure to harsh environmental conditions.

 

▲ Corrosion Protection

 

Implement measures to protect rail clips from corrosion, such as applying corrosion-resistant coatings or galvanizing. Regularly inspect the condition of the coatings and touch up or reapply as necessary to prevent corrosion damage to the rail clips.

 

▲ Specialized Maintenance

 

Some types of rail clips, such as elastic clips or Pandrol clips, may require specialized maintenance procedures. Follow the manufacturer's recommendations for inspection, adjustment, and maintenance of these clips to ensure optimal performance.

 

▲ Record Keeping

 

Maintain detailed records of rail clip maintenance activities, including inspection dates, findings, repairs, and replacements. This information helps track the condition of rail clips over time and identify trends or patterns that may require attention.

▲Rail Clips application▲

 

▲ Preparation

 

Before installing rail clips, the railway track must be properly prepared. This includes ensuring that the rail base is clean, level, and free of debris or obstructions that could interfere with the installation process.

 

▲ Positioning

 

Rail clips are positioned along the rail at predetermined intervals based on the track design and specifications. The spacing between rail clips depends on factors such as rail type, track curvature, and anticipated loads.

 

▲ Installation

 

Rail clips are typically installed by placing them onto the rail base and securing them in place using bolts or other fasteners. The clips are positioned so that they grip the rail tightly, providing sufficient clamping force to hold the rail securely in place.

 

▲ Adjustment

 

In some cases, rail clips may require adjustment to ensure proper alignment and tension. This may involve tightening or loosening bolts to achieve the desired clamping force and ensure that the rail is securely fastened to the base.

 

▲ Verification

 

Once rail clips are installed, they are inspected to ensure that they are properly positioned and securely fastened to the rail base. This may involve visual inspections or using specialized tools to measure clamping force and alignment.

 

▲ Resilient Pads

 

In some track systems, resilient pads or insulators are installed between the rail and the rail clip to dampen vibration and reduce noise. These pads help improve the performance and longevity of the rail clip assembly.

 

▲ Final Checks

 

After installation, final checks are conducted to verify the integrity and stability of the rail clip assembly. This includes ensuring that all bolts are properly tightened, and there are no signs of damage or defects that could affect the performance of the rail clip.

Q: What are rail clips used for?

A: Rail clip is a component of railway fastening systems. It is used to fix the railroad track to the underlying baseplate and sleepers. The clamping force by rail clips helps to maintain the gauge and prevent the rail from moving in the vertical and horizontal direction relative to the sleeper.

 

Q: What is the process of elastic rail clip manufacturing?

A: The schedule of production process is as follows: Shearing → Heating to forging temperature → Forming → Hardening → Tempering → Inspection → Packing. The raw material which is spring steel bar has to be sheared as per length required. The sheared rods are heated to the forging temperature at 950OC to 1000OC.
